Recently, ORG have been making increased use of legal challenges to achieve our goals. This page details ORG's current and notable legal work.

DPAct Immigration Exemption Challenge
Applying for appeal
The Data Protection Act is supposed to be all about giving people more access to their data. But the Act's immigration exemption does the opposite.
